A Code Orange air quality alert (Ozone) has been issued for DC Thursday, 4/24. This means air quality is unhealthy for sensitive groups. Older adults, children, pregnant women & those w/ respiratory illnesses should limit outdoor exercise. Conditions are likely to continue through Friday. Visit airnow.gov for latest data.

Tonight, temperatures in DC are forecasted to drop as low as 21 degrees.
Key cold weather tips:
🧥Dress in layers
⏲️Limit time outdoors
❄️Know the symptoms of frostbite & hypothermia
📞Call the Shelter Hotline for a neighbor in need: (202) 399-7093
